The Amazon River is a vast waterway flowing through the world's largest tropical rainforest, with thousands of fish species inhabiting its water system. Recreating this unique environment in a home aquarium is what we call an "Amazon River Biotope." A biotope is a captive environment that mimics a specific ecosystem. Rather than simply keeping South American fish, by adjusting the water chemistry, substrate, aquatic plants, and driftwood to match the natural habitat, fish display their true beauty and natural behaviors.
What is Amazon River Water Chemistry? Understanding Black Water
Many tributaries of the Amazon River feature water called "black water"—a transparent, dark amber to brownish water similar in appearance to tea. This water type is created when fallen leaves, driftwood, and decomposing organic matter from the rainforest release tannins and humic acids into the water column.
Black water has the following characteristics:
- pH: 4.5–6.5 (weakly acidic to acidic)
- Hardness (GH): 0–4°dH (extremely soft water)
- Color: transparent amber to dark brown
- Rich in organic matter with diverse bacterial communities
Japan's tap water is neutral to weakly alkaline and tends toward hardness, making it unsuitable for Amazon fish in its natural state. To match water chemistry, use RO water (reverse osmosis purified water) or a softening filter, and add peat moss or almond leaves (leaves of Terminalia catappa) to supplement tannins. Commercial "black water additives" are also convenient and effective.
Beginners should start by measuring pH and hardness, then gradually adjust toward target values—this approach minimizes failure.
Recommended South American Tropical Fish: Choosing Your Show Pieces
Selecting the primary fish species is the most enjoyable step in establishing a biotope. Here are representative tropical fish species native to the Amazon river system.
Discus
Called the "king of tropical fish," this large cichlid has significant body depth and comes in colorful varieties featuring red, blue, and green. It prefers weakly acidic soft water and high temperatures (28–31°C). While sometimes delicate and better suited for experienced aquarists, it's not difficult to keep if water chemistry is properly established.
Angelfish
A medium-sized cichlid with an elegant diamond-shaped silhouette stretched vertically. They look graceful swimming slowly between driftwood and aquatic plants, making them ideal for biotope displays. They're easy to keep at pH 6.0–7.0 and 25–28°C, and are suitable for beginners.
Cardinal Tetra
A small characin with striking red and blue stripes. When kept in schools, they instantly add vibrancy to the aquarium. They prefer weakly acidic soft water and are a classic pairing with Angelfish.
Corydoras (South American species)
Small catfish that dart around the bottom layer. Numerous Amazon-origin species are available, such as Corydoras adolfoi and Corydoras schwartzi. They also serve the practical function of cleaning up leftover food from the substrate.
Apistogramma
A small cichlid that can be kept as a pair, allowing observation of breeding behavior. At around 5 cm in length, they look striking even in planted aquariums.
When selecting fish, keep in mind that they should be "from the same geographical origin." Fish that naturally overlap in habitat tend to have compatible water chemistry preferences and experience fewer conflicts in mixed-species tanks.
Layout Basics: Choosing Driftwood, Substrate, and Aquatic Plants
Achieving both "natural aesthetics" and "functionality" is crucial for an Amazon River biotope layout.
Driftwood
Branch wood or old black wood with spreading fine branches suits the South American atmosphere. Since untreated driftwood releases large amounts of tannins from its organic content, you can either pre-soak it for several days to a week, or deliberately harness the tannins to help establish black water chemistry.
Substrate
While the Amazon River bottom is typically fine white sand, biotope aquariums commonly use nutrient-rich soils like "Amazonia." Nutrient soil lowers pH, softens water, and promotes aquatic plant growth. For easier maintenance, apply substrate thinly.
Aquatic Plants
Selecting aquatic plants native to the Amazon River enhances the completeness of the biotope.
- Echinodorus (Amazon Sword, etc.): Large leaves evoke a South American atmosphere and readily propagate via runners.
- Anubias barteri: Attaching to driftwood or rocks creates a natural appearance and grows even in low light.
- Vallisneria and Water Wisteria: Useful background plants for adding height.
- Willow Moss: When attached to driftwood, creates a stream-like aesthetic.
Aquatic plants are classified as either "shade-tolerant (low-light OK)" or "light-demanding (high-light required)." With proper CO₂ supplementation and lighting, you can enjoy a more diverse plant palette.
Equipment and Water Management: Keys to Long-Term Success
Proper equipment selection and daily maintenance are essential for maintaining a beautiful biotope aquarium.
Filtration
External filters are best suited for biotopes. They allow gentle water flow and provide excellent biological filtration capacity. External filters from brands like Eheim and Kotobuki are standard choices. Select flow rate based on 5–10 times the tank volume per hour.
Lighting
Aquatic plants require 8–10 hours of light daily. LED lighting has low running costs and typically uses white-spectrum bulbs around 6500K color temperature. For certain plant species, adding red and blue LEDs can accelerate growth.
Heater
For Discus, maintain 28–31°C. For Angelfish and Cardinal Tetras, 26–28°C is ideal. Use a thermostat-equipped heater to minimize temperature fluctuations.
CO₂ Supplementation
Essential for serious aquatic plant cultivation. Start with a small cylinder and upgrade to larger ones as needed. CO₂ addition also lowers pH, making it highly compatible with Amazon aquariums.
Water Changes and Top-Offs
Perform 20–30% water changes weekly as a baseline. Always dechlorinate tap water and adjust pH and hardness before use. Adding almond leaves or peat moss simplifies water quality maintenance.
Setup Procedure: The First Month is Critical
Taking a patient approach to establishing a biotope aquarium is the key to success.
- Tank and Equipment Setup and Cleaning (Day 1): Rinse and install the tank, substrate, and driftwood. Anchor driftwood with weights to keep it submerged.
- Water Fill and Filter Start (Days 1–3): Let substrate settle for several days before full operation.
- Aquatic Plant Planting (Days 3–5): Plant in order: background → midground → foreground.
- Introduction of Pilot Fish (1 Week): Add a small number of hardy small fish like Cardinal Tetras first to establish beneficial bacteria.
- Water Chemistry Check and Adjustment (Weeks 2–4): Regularly measure ammonia, nitrite, pH, and hardness. Once stable, gradually increase fish populations.
- Addition of Main Species (After 1 Month): Introduce Discus and Angelfish last.
In early setup stages, ammonia and nitrite spike easily, destabilizing fish health. Using bacterial supplements and gradually adding fish through staged introductions are keys to long-term success.
